I read the President's comments. You only read one line. I read three paragraphs--he never said, ``The Democrats in the Senate are not interested in national security.'' That was the maddening quote. He never said it--never said it. Yet it was accepted that he said it. That is wrong. It was stated on last night's TV, stated in this morning's floor debate. I heard one or two people say he impugned the integrity of the entire Democratic caucus. No, he didn't. Read what the President said. He even complimented Democrats. He said both Republicans and Democrats are working hard to pass a good bill. There are consequences to words. Words are important. I read the President's statements both at the Forrester event and the Thune event. They were not offensive, and they never stated what was said on the floor of the Senate. They were misconstrued somehow, some way. That is unfortunate because there are consequences to our words. There are some people who listen. There are headlines. I haven't read what the European papers have said, but I don't look forward to that because I am afraid it sends the wrong signals. I do agree with my colleagues, we should improve the quality of debate in the Senate. If we ever quote anybody, we should quote them accurately.
